Local Courts
Immigration cases in Redmond are handled by the Seattle Immigration Court located in Tukwila, which serves the Western Washington region including King County.
Washington Law
Washington Immigration Laws & Deadlines
Washington state provides certain protections for immigrants, including laws limiting cooperation with federal immigration enforcement and access to state services regardless of immigration status. The Washington TRUST Act restricts local law enforcement's ability to detain individuals based solely on immigration violations. While immigration law is primarily federal, Washington's immigrant-friendly policies can impact strategy in removal defense and other immigration matters.

How long does it take to process immigration cases through the Seattle USCIS office serving Redmond?
Processing times vary by case type, but the Seattle USCIS Field Office currently processes naturalization applications in approximately 12-18 months and employment-based green cards in 2-3 years. Your Redmond immigration attorney can provide current processing estimates for your specific case type.
What immigration services are most commonly needed in Redmond's tech community?
H-1B visa applications, PERM labor certifications, and employment-based green card petitions are frequently needed by Redmond's technology workers. Many tech employees also require assistance with dependent visas for spouses and children, as well as adjustment of status applications.
